What's Going on Today?
- It's Super Tuesday! That means voters in 24 states will either head to the polls or line up to caucus to cast their votes in the presidential primary. More than 1,000 delegates are up for grabs, just less than the half needed to secure a party's nomination.

On This Day:
In 1953: Walt Disney's "Peter Pan," about a boy who refuses to grow up (sound familiar?), opens at the Roxy Theater in New York City.
In 1958: The U.S. Air Force loses a hydrogen bomb known as the Tybee Bomb off the coast of Savannah, Georgia, never to be recovered.
In 1969: Vince Lombardi becomes part owner, vice president, general manager and head coach of the Washington Redskins.
In 1972: Bob Douglas becomes the first African-American elected to the Basketball Hall of Fame.
In 1989: Kareem Abdul-Jabar becomes the first NBA player to score 38,000 points.
